下列哪个git命令不是合并代码

不及物动词 其他 122

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    下列哪个git命令不是合并代码?

    A. git merge
    B. git rebase
    C. git push
    D. git pull

    答案:C. git push

    解析:git merge是合并分支的命令,通过将两个不同的分支合并成一个分支。git rebase也是合并分支的命令,但是它会将一个分支上的提交应用到另一个分支上。git pull是从远程仓库获取最新的代码,并将其与本地分支合并。而git push是将本地分支推送到远程仓库。所以,git push不是合并代码的命令,它是将本地代码推送到远程仓库的命令。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    下列是5个不属于合并代码的git命令:

    1. `git push`:将本地代码推送到远程仓库。该命令用于将本地代码变更上传到远程仓库,并不涉及代码合并的操作。

    2. `git pull`:从远程仓库拉取代码并合并到本地分支。虽然该命令中的合并操作可以发生,但它主要用于将远程仓库的更新同步到本地分支,并不作为独立的合并代码的命令。

    3. `git checkout`:切换分支或还原文件。该命令主要用于在不同的分支之间切换,或者恢复文件的状态,没有直接的合并代码的功能。

    4. `git stash`:保存当前工作进度并切换到其他分支。该命令可用于保存当前的工作进度,以便在切换分支后恢复工作进度,但并不直接进行代码的合并。

    5. `git branch`:查看、创建或删除分支。该命令用于管理分支,包括查看当前分支、创建新分支、删除分支等操作,并不直接涉及到代码合并的过程。

    这些命令在git中起着重要的作用,但它们并不是直接用于合并代码的命令。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在git中,合并代码是一个重要的操作,可以将不同的分支或者不同的提交合并成一个新的提交。下面是常用的合并代码的命令:

    1. git merge:这是最常用的合并代码命令。使用该命令可以将指定分支的代码合并到当前分支。

    2. git rebase:该命令可以将一个分支上的提交移到另一个分支上,从而实现合并代码的效果。它可以将提交的顺序更改,创建一个线性的提交历史。

    3. git cherry-pick:使用该命令可以选择性地合并一个或多个提交。可以选择任意分支或提交,将其应用于当前分支。

    4. git pull:该命令相当于执行了git fetch和git merge两个命令,它会从远程仓库拉取最新的代码,然后将其合并到当前分支。

    根据题目的要求,需要找到不是合并代码的git命令。根据上述介绍,git pull命令不是合并代码的命令,它是从远程仓库拉取最新的代码,并将其合并到当前分支。

    下面是git pull的操作流程:

    1. 在要拉取代码的分支上执行git pull命令。

    2. git fetch会从远程仓库拉取最新的代码到本地的隐藏分支origin/master(或者其他远程分支名)。

    3. git merge会将本地的分支和隐藏分支进行合并。如果存在冲突,会需要手动解决冲突。

    通过以上操作,git pull会将远程仓库最新的代码合并到本地的分支。

    总结:

    在git中,合并代码是一个常见的操作。除了git pull命令外,其他的git命令如git merge、git rebase、git cherry-pick都可以用来合并不同的代码。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部